The learned counsel for the appellant submits that the products imported by them are water purifiers and they are not household type filters specified in CTH 8421 21 20. Therefore, they are rightly classifiable under CTH 84212190 under the category Other . Further, they are eligible for CVD exemption under Notification No. 6/2006, dated 1-3-2006 under Sr. No. 8B which grants exemption from excise duty in respect of water purification equipment based on technologies, which inter alia includes reverse osmosis technology using thin film composite membrane. ..... hat and not to residual entry. In the present case, Heading 8421 21 20 is the specific entry and 8421 21 90 is the residual entry. Therefore, following the above principle, 8421 21 20 has to be preferred over 8421 21 90. 5.9 The Hon ble Apex Court in the case of CCE, Ghaziabad v. International Tobacco Co. Ltd. - 2008 (231) E.L.T. 207 (S.C.) held that the basic character, function and use is more important than the name used in trade parlance. In the present case there is no doubt that the goods in question, filters/purifies water and, therefore, it qualifies to be classified as a filter. 5.10 Further, in the case of Philips India Ltd. v.
